### Timezones in report exports (yes, really)

Quick context before your review: the Fernvale export pipeline stores everything in UTC and converts at render time using the requesting org's configured zone — never the viewer's browser. That matters for audit trails, since two users can see different timestamps for the same event. DST transitions are handled by the Hollowtick library; we pin its zone database version per release. The full conversion spec and audit notes are on the internal page.

runbook for tafof-yawif: https://confluence.tolvaqsys.internal/display/display/browse/pages/7be3

## Tuning: Image Slimming in Crateler

Crateler's slimming pass strips build artifacts, flattens layers, and prunes locale data. Be careful: aggressive pruning can remove runtime dependencies, so always run the smoke suite after changing thresholds. As a new contractor, start by adjusting only the layer-merge depth and leave the prune allowlist alone until you've shipped a few builds. The defaults we currently ship, validated on the Ternbury fleet, are these.

limits module of tahof-tawig:
WEIGHTS = {
    "fenwyn": 285,
    "briiel": 528,
    "druiel": 1023,
    "kasax": 747,
    "jordor": 334,
}

# Tollgate Consent Banner — Environments

The Tollgate consent banner rolls out across three environments: sandbox, preview, and production. Sandbox disables consent persistence entirely; preview stores choices in Varnholt-region storage only; production enforces regional residency. Reviewers should confirm that logging excludes pre-consent identifiers. Each environment's enforced configuration appears below.

config for hawep-taweg:
[frair]
port = 8443
region = west-3
host = frair.sivrelhq.internal
team = oliael
timeout_ms = 1000
retries = 2